Skip to content

Commit fb09447

Browse files
[flang] Fix a warning
This patch fixes: flang/unittests/Runtime/CommandTest.cpp:702:14: error: variable length arrays are a C99 feature [-Werror,-Wvla-extension]
1 parent cf3421d commit fb09447

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

flang/unittests/Runtime/CommandTest.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-699,10 +699,10 @@ TEST_F(EnvironmentVariables, GetlogPadSpace) {
699699
if (charLen == -1)
700700
charLen = _POSIX_LOGIN_NAME_MAX + 2;
701701
#endif
702-
char input[charLen];
702+
std::vector<char> input(charLen);
703703

704704
FORTRAN_PROCEDURE_NAME(getlog)
705-
(reinterpret_cast<std::byte *>(input), charLen);
705+
(reinterpret_cast<std::byte *>(input.data()), charLen);
706706

707707
EXPECT_EQ(input[charLen - 1], ' ');
708708
}

0 commit comments

Comments
 (0)